Risk Management

Training courses to foster positive safety outcomes

Viristar offers comprehensive, engaging trainings designed to help outdoor, adventure and experiential professionals achieve excellence in safety outcomes.

Our acclaimed Risk Management for Outdoor Programs 40-hour online training is considered a world-leading outdoor safety course. Participants from over 60 countries on six continents have benefited from this rigorous course, which takes place over four weeks (29 days).

Viristar also offers a free COVID-19 risk management course. This is a legacy product but contains public health guidance applicable beyond the COVID-19 pandemic.

In addition to risk management trainings, Viristar also offers other risk management services, including risk management audits, incident reviews, expert witness services, adventure safety accreditation, and support with developing safety system documents, procedures and systems.

Risk Management for Outdoor Programs

Rigorous and intensive online training course, taking 40 hours over four weeks (29 days)

Content includes safety science, incident causation models, risk assessment, human factors, systems thinking, legal considerations, documentation, emergency response, safety management systems, and much more

Curriculum designed for managers of adventure, experiential, wilderness and travel-based programs

Course includes five once-a-week video-conference calls with approximately 10 hours of independent work between each call

Textbook included with training. Course completion certificate valid for three years.  Custom courses also available.
